Total laparoscopic pylorus-preserving pancreatoduodenectomy for periampullary tumor

The authors show an edited video of a total laparoscopic modified Whipple procedure for an ampullary adenocarcinoma. The patient was obese wth a BMI of 35.6 kg/m2. Surgery was performed at the Hospital Federal de Ipanema in Rio de Janeiro, Brazil. Hand-sewn pancreatico-jejunostomy, choledocho-jejunostomy and duodeno-jenunostomy in a single-loop were performed. Total operative time was 450 minutes with an estimated blood loss of 200mL. The surgical specimen was taken out by a small incision at the left flank, through which a jejunostomy was performed.
